Lady L (1989) presents a deep dive into the struggles of small-town life juxtaposed against the chaos of Manila. The film's tone feels gritty, capturing the essence of both hardship and resilience. The pacing is a bit uneven, but that’s part of its charm; it mirrors the unpredictable nature of life itself. Performances here strike a chord—there's a rawness that makes you feel for the characters. The practical effects, while modest, add to the authenticity of the setting, immersing you in the atmosphere of a place where dreams clash with reality. It's an interesting reflection on the human condition, with a distinctive approach to storytelling that lingers with you long after the credits roll.
